Benefits of Septic Tank Installation
• Customized System Fit
Installers size the tank and drain field based on household use and local soil capacity. This prevents overloading and system failure on your property.
• Regulatory Compliance
Local installers secure necessary permits and ensure placement meets setback rules, depth requirements, and inspection standards in Asbury Park.
• Efficient Wastewater Management
Correctly installed tanks and drain fields ensure wastewater is treated and absorbed without pooling or backups, maintaining system efficiency.
• Durable Installation Materials
Professionals in Asbury Park use materials suited for local climate—resistant tanks, frost-proof piping, and compacted fill reduce risks of damage or shifting.
• Long-Term Performance Assurance
A quality installation lays the groundwork for effective long-term operation, helping avoid major repairs or system replacement later.
FAQ
How long does septic installation take? Typical installations take 1–3 days depending on site prep and weather conditions.
Do I need soil testing? Yes—percolation or soil absorption tests are required to design the drain field correctly.
Who handles permits? Licensed installers secure all necessary permits and schedule inspections with local authorities.
Can I use any septic tank type? Installers recommend tanks based on household size, soil type, and local regulations—usually concrete, plastic, or polyethylene.
When can I use the system? Use is typically safe once the final inspection is approved and backfill has been settled.
